在现代远程办公和跨地域访问日益普及的背景下,虚拟私人网络(VPN)已成为企业、教育机构和个人用户保障网络安全的重要工具,许多用户在使用过程中经常会遇到“认证失败”的提示,这不仅影响工作效率,还可能引发对网络安全性或配置正确性的担忧,作为一名经验丰富的网络工程师,我将为你系统梳理常见的VPN认证失败原因,并提供一套可操作的排查与解决方案。

要明确“认证失败”通常意味着客户端无法通过服务器的身份验证,即用户名、密码、证书或令牌等凭证未被正确识别,最常见的原因包括:

  1. 账号信息错误:这是最基础但也最容易被忽略的问题,请仔细核对用户名和密码是否区分大小写,是否有空格或特殊字符输入错误,如果使用的是双因素认证(2FA),还需确认一次性验证码是否正确且未过期。

  2. 账户状态异常:某些企业级VPN服务(如Cisco AnyConnect、FortiClient或Microsoft Azure VPN)会绑定AD域账户,若用户账户被锁定、禁用或过期,也会导致认证失败,建议联系IT管理员检查账户状态。

  3. 证书问题:对于基于数字证书的SSL/TLS-VPN连接,客户端证书可能已过期、未正确安装,或服务器端证书不被信任,此时应检查本地证书存储区,必要时重新导入证书。

  4. 时间不同步:部分认证机制(如Kerberos或OAuth)依赖精确的时间同步,若客户端设备时间与服务器相差超过5分钟,认证将直接失败,请确保设备时区设置正确,并启用NTP自动同步。

  5. 防火墙或代理干扰:企业内网常部署严格的防火墙策略,可能阻止特定端口(如UDP 500、4500用于IPsec,TCP 443用于OpenVPN)的通信,代理服务器也可能拦截HTTPS请求,建议临时关闭防火墙测试,或联系网络管理员开放所需端口。

  6. 软件版本兼容性:旧版客户端可能不支持新版本的加密算法或协议,务必更新到官方最新版本,特别是当服务器升级后出现兼容性问题时。

  7. ISP限制或IP封禁:部分地区运营商或企业网络可能限制P2P流量或禁止非标准端口,从而间接导致认证失败,尝试切换网络环境(如手机热点)进行测试。

作为网络工程师,在实际工作中,我推荐按以下步骤逐步排查:

  • 第一步:重启客户端并清除缓存;
  • 第二步:使用ping和telnet命令测试服务器可达性;
  • 第三步:查看日志文件(如Windows事件查看器或客户端日志),定位具体错误代码;
  • 第四步:联系技术支持,提供详细日志和错误码以加快响应。

VPN认证失败并非无解难题,只要掌握基本原理并按逻辑顺序排查,大多数问题都能迎刃而解,耐心、细致和良好的文档记录是解决问题的关键,如果你是普通用户,请勿随意修改配置文件;若你是IT运维人员,建立标准化的故障处理流程将极大提升效率。

VPN认证失败怎么办?网络工程师教你快速排查与解决方法  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速